Straightforward Modifications for Better Air Circulation



When it comes to keeping your PC cool, sometimes small changes can make a big difference. Let's examine a few simple changes to better airflow and improve system performance.

First of all, think about adding or improving your case fans. Many PC cases include a small number of fans, which might not guarantee efficient air circulation. By installing more fans, especially those with high airflow ratings, you'll optimize cooling. Positioning one fan to pull air in and another to push air out can create a nice flow that keeps things chill.

Following this, look at your cable management. It might appear unimportant, but messy cables can block airflow and warm up your PC. Neaten things up by using zip ties or Velcro straps to group cables. If you can manage to route them behind the motherboard tray, it’s even more effective! With fewer blocks, cool air can travel more freely through your case.


Wrapping up, be aware of dust accumulation. It can build up and block your fans and vents over time. Consistently cleaning dust from your case and components is important for airflow. A compressed air canister can assist with hard-to-reach spots and ensure smooth running.

Finding the Perfect Cooling Method

First, contemplate the cooling solution that suits your requirements. Here are the main routes:

Fan Cooling: This is the most prevalent and generally the most inexpensive choice. It uses fans and heat sinks to manage warmth. If you are looking for a simple and efficient solution, this might be it.

Liquid Cooling: For those who look for improved performance, liquid cooling can be a great plan. It’s frequently quieter and can manage larger heat loads, perfect for overclocking.

Passive Cooling: This method relies exclusively on heat sinks, needing no fans. It’s noise-free and energy-efficient but not ideal for high-performance systems.



After that, think about your PC case and components. Verify that the cooling solution you pick fits well within your setup. Check your case measurements and verify that your motherboard and RAM clearances are fine. You don’t want to acquire a solution only to realize it won’t fit!

Ultimately, think about installation and maintenance. Some solutions like all-in-one liquid cooling solutions are simpler to install, but custom loops can be difficult. If you’re not familiar with intricate configurations, air coolers are usually more straightforward to manage. Also, don't neglect regular cleaning! Dust accumulation can harm performance, so select a solution that is simple to clean.
